Ask a Gulf importer what went wrong with last season and you rarely hear about freight rates. You hear about the pallet of one SKU that never moved, the line that was gone before the first weekend was over, and the fact that both travelled in the same container. A fireworks container is not a bulk purchase. It is a range decision with a sailing date attached, and the sailing date is the easy part.

What Actually Caps the Load, and It Isn’t Weight
Every container has three theoretical limits: volume, weight, and the quantity of explosive it is allowed to carry. With consumer fireworks, one of those three is almost never the binding constraint.
The numbers explain why. A 20ft dry container offers roughly 33 cubic metres of nominal internal volume, a 40ft about 67, and a 40ft high cube around 76. On paper each is rated to carry something in the region of 28 tonnes, although destination road limits often cut what you can actually move to nearer 21 to 24.
Nominal volume is not what you load either, and the gap is bigger than most first-time buyers expect. Once pallets, loading access, dunnage and securing are accounted for, a mixed dangerous-goods load in a 20ft usually works out at around 22 CBM, roughly two thirds of the nominal figure and the number most Liuyang exporters plan against. Now consider what goes inside: printed cartons of cakes and fountains, largely full of air, clay, paper tubes and packaging. A load of that description reaches the roof of the container while the weight is still in the low-to-mid teens of tonnes.
So the first ceiling is cube. The second is net explosive quantity: the mass of explosive substance in the consignment, excluding packaging and inert material. The transport documents and the IMDG Code call it net explosive mass; most of the trade says NEQ, and this guide follows the trade. The two behave differently, which is why both need stating. Cube is a property of your cartons, NEQ is a property of your product classification, and improving one can quietly worsen the other.

Start With the Licence, Not With the Catalogue
The most common sequencing error in a first Gulf order is to build the wish list first and check the permissions afterwards. It should run the other way round, because the licence held by the importer of record determines which product can even appear on the list.
Two questions settle most of the shape of the container. First, is the buyer selling to the public or supplying shows? A retail distributor works within consumer product and shelf economics; a display contractor buys against firing plans and needs professional-grade material, which is a different licence conversation in every Gulf state. The distinction is more consequential than most catalogues suggest, and our comparison of consumer and display fireworks sets out where the line falls.
Second, what does the licence say about quantity? Explosives licences in the region are typically written against a storage location and a permitted quantity, not against a product list. That figure, expressed in explosive content rather than cartons, is the constraint that catches importers out, and it is what the magazine section below deals with.
What the Rules Let You Put in One Box
Mixing is not a commercial preference; it is a regulated question with a published answer. Under the IMDG Code, goods of Class 1 may be stowed in the same closed cargo transport unit only where the permitted mixed-stowage table allows it. Fireworks sit in compatibility group G, and group G with group G carries an X in that table, which is the technical reason a mixed fireworks container is possible at all.
Two provisions in the same chapter matter as much as the table itself:
| Combination | One container? | What it does to the load |
|---|---|---|
| 1.4G with 1.4G (UN0336) | Yes | The standard consumer mixed load. Same division, same compatibility group, one set of stowage conditions. |
| 1.4G with 1.4S (UN0337) | Yes | Compatibility group S may be stowed with all other groups. Useful for small novelty and low-hazard lines. |
| 1.4G with 1.3G (UN0335) | Permitted, but… | Where divisions are mixed, the entire load is treated as the more dangerous division and stowage must meet the most stringent provisions for the whole load. Your consumer container becomes a 1.3 shipment. |
| Fireworks with group C, D or E articles | No | The note that lets group G articles travel with C, D and E explicitly excludes fireworks, so a general group G allowance cannot be assumed for a fireworks load. |
The practical reading: a container is cheapest and simplest when every line in it shares one division. The moment a 1.3G-classified line joins a 1.4G load, the classification of the whole box changes, and with it the stowage, potentially the freight, and often what the destination approval has to cover. Note that this turns on the classification assigned to the article by test and approval, not on how a supplier chooses to market it.
There is a second reason to keep the divisions apart, and at destination it bites harder than freight does. Retail importers are usually licensed for consumer product, which in most Gulf states means 1.4G and 1.4S. A 1.3G line arriving inside that load can put the whole container outside what the licence covers, even though the mixing itself was lawful at sea. If a display line genuinely belongs in your programme, it is normally cleaner as a separate consignment against the appropriate permission than as a few cartons riding along in a retail box.
That is why classification comes before assortment rather than after. Divisions are assigned to the article by test and approval, not chosen by the seller, and the reasoning behind those five UN entries is set out in our guide to UN numbers and shipping classifications. Worth restating, because quotations blur it: 1.3G and 1.4G are transport divisions, not marketing categories. A product is not consumer-grade because someone typed 1.4G on an offer sheet.
The Ceiling Most Buyers Forget: The Magazine at the Other End
A container that is legal to load in China can still be impossible to receive. Explosives licensing is administered state by state across the Gulf, but the pattern importers consistently describe to us is the same: the permission attaches to an approved storage facility, and it carries a permitted quantity stated in explosive content. Because the detail differs between states and the licence sits with the importer of record, that figure has to be read off the licence itself rather than estimated by a supplier. If it allows less than your container carries, the shortfall is not a paperwork problem at the port. It is a cargo with nowhere compliant to go, accruing dangerous-goods storage charges while the position is sorted out.
The order of checks that avoids this takes one email:
- The importer confirms the licensed quantity at the receiving magazine, and how much of it is already committed to existing stock.
- The factory returns per-SKU explosive content for the proposed list, so the container total can be added up before anything is manufactured.
- Both figures are compared before the assortment is finalised, not after the booking.

A Three-Layer Assortment, and What Each Layer Is For
With the constraints established, the question becomes how to divide the space. What follows is a planning device rather than market research, and it works best as the opening structure for a conversation with a distributor who knows their own shelf:
- Core. Proven repeat lines, ordered in depth. Predictable turnover funds the shipment, and deep cartons per line keep unit costs and handling manageable.
- Seasonal. Product tied to one window: Eid family packs, National Day colour themes, wedding-season lines. Timing matters more than range here, because the same carton is high-margin on time and dead weight late.
- Trial. A deliberately small number of new lines, each in minimum cartons. Next season's core tends to come from here, and the layer stays small so that a line that fails costs shelf space rather than licensed magazine capacity.
The discipline that makes this work is not the ratio but the sizing rule on the trial layer: it is measured in cartons you can afford to write off. A third of a container of untested product is not a trial.
What Each Product Family Actually Does in a Gulf Mix
Product families are not interchangeable volume. They occupy different amounts of cube per unit of retail value, and they answer to different buyers.
- Multi-shot cakes are the commercial centre of most consumer loads. One item delivers a complete sequence, which is what a family buying a single product for an evening wants. They are also bulky, so they dominate the cube calculation and should be counted first.
- Fountains are ground-based and lower noise, which makes them the natural answer where aerial effects are restricted or a venue is enclosed. Dense relative to their retail price, so they use space efficiently.
- Sparklers and hand-held items have small cube and high unit counts, and they are the impulse purchase that brings families into the category. In our order books, sparkler quantities are usually the first thing a Gulf distributor raises on a repeat order.
- Roman candles ship in long, thin cartons that stack efficiently, and they give a mid-price step between hand-held items and cakes.
- Novelties are small in volume and useful for filling gaps in a load. Keep them to a defined block so they do not quietly become a third of the SKU count.

Eid and a National Day Are Two Different Containers
Gulf demand is not one season with peaks. It runs on two calendars: the Islamic calendar, which moves earlier each year against the Gregorian one, and fixed national dates. That single fact reshapes load planning more than any product decision.
Eid demand concentrates into a short, intense window with family buying at its centre: hand-held items, fountains, and mid-range cakes in depth, ordered against a date that shifts annually. National Day demand skews larger and more public, with institutional buyers, brand colour themes and bigger single items, and it sits on a fixed date, which makes it easier to plan and more crowded to book. Serving both from one shipment is entirely reasonable for a smaller market: one arrival, one shipment-approval cycle, one freight bill. Note what does and does not get consolidated: the approval attached to the shipment is handled once, while sales and event permissions at destination are still dealt with season by season. The cost is that the earlier window dictates the arrival date, so the later season's product waits in storage through the hottest months of the year. The Gulf then adds a constraint of its own.
Heat, Storage and Why Turnover Is a Compliance Issue
Many pyrotechnic compositions draw moisture from the air, and heat compounds what that moisture does. In a Gulf summer, a magazine without climate control is a harsher environment than most manufacturing markets design for, and the failure mode is gradual rather than dramatic: fuses that become temperamental, cardboard that softens, effects that no longer perform the way the sample did. The planning consequence argues against the instinct to buy big. A container sized to the selling window ties up less licensed capacity, spends less time in heat, and leaves room to react when one line sells out. Overbuying turns a commercial misjudgement into a storage problem, and storage here is licensed, finite and expensive.
Doing the Carton Arithmetic Before You Commit
The check that separates a plan from a wish list takes an afternoon with a spreadsheet, and it runs in one direction: from cartons upward. Six figures decide the load, and each one has an owner. Every line starts with the outside dimensions of the export carton rather than the size of the product inside it; units per carton and net explosive content per carton come off the same packing and classification paperwork.
| Step | Figure you need | Where it comes from | What it decides |
|---|---|---|---|
| 1 | Export carton dimensions and units per carton, line by line | Factory packing specification | Cube per carton, and the smallest quantity that line can ship in |
| 2 | Cartons per line, rounded up to whole cartons | Your quantity divided by units per carton | Cube per line. Part cartons do not ship, so this is where a wish list first meets reality |
| 3 | Total cube for the load | Sum of step 2 | Compared against practical loaded volume. For a 20ft mixed DG load, plan against about 22 CBM rather than the 33 CBM nominal figure |
| 4 | Net explosive content per unit, line by line | Factory classification and approval documents | NEQ per line |
| 5 | Total NEQ for the load | Sum of step 4 | Compared against the licensed quantity at the receiving magazine |
| 6 | Gross weight | Carton gross weight multiplied by carton count | Compared against the payload rating and any destination road limit |
An illustration of why step 3 usually bites first. Plan a 20ft mixed load against roughly 22 CBM rather than the 33 CBM nominal figure. If the cartons across your mix average out at about 0.025 m³, say a 40 × 30 × 20 cm box, that comes to somewhere near 880 cartons, which is why a first mixed container of consumer fireworks usually lands in the region of 800 to 1,200 cartons. A load of that description rarely comes near a 28-tonne payload rating, and that is the whole reason the volume line is reached long before the weight line.
Step 5 can tighten the picture further, and sometimes it is the figure that decides the load size rather than the cube. Both checks belong before the booking rather than after it.
Three figures, three owners. Cube belongs to the carton specification, explosive content to the classification, and payload to the carrier. Derive all three from one document set: a sales spreadsheet that becomes a second source of truth will eventually disagree with the packing list, and that disagreement tends to surface at a port.
Freeze the Brand and the Label Before the Load Is Built
Assortment decisions and artwork decisions are usually made by different people, which is why they collide so often. A late SKU substitution is a small commercial adjustment and a significant labelling event: printed cartons, retail packs and the shipment file all describe specific articles, and swapping a line after artwork is frozen means either a reprint or a set of documents that no longer match the cargo.
The sequence that avoids the collision is to settle the list, then classify, then print, and to treat any change after that point as a change to all three layers rather than to a line item. Sample Set First, Full Load Second
For a first order into a new market, the cheapest insurance available is to see the product perform before it ships in quantity. A proof-firing of the proposed core lines answers questions a specification sheet cannot: whether the effect duration matches the description, whether the sequence reads well at the distance a customer will watch it from, whether two cakes in the list are close enough that one is redundant.
The same visit is when carton marks, retail labels and paperwork should be reconciled against each other, while everything is still in China and a correction costs a reprint rather than a supervised operation at a dangerous-goods terminal. Replenishment is a different exercise, and it should be. A first container is a range experiment with a wide trial layer and even coverage; a replenishment is a reorder where the trial layer shrinks to whatever the previous season proved. What matters is that the second order is built from sell-through records rather than from the first order's file. A container repeated because it was easy to repeat is how a slow line ends up occupying licensed storage for another year.
Frequently Asked Questions
How many SKUs can you fit in one 20ft container of fireworks?
There is no rule that caps SKU count, because the limit is cartons rather than codes. A 20ft offers roughly 33 cubic metres nominal, but a mixed dangerous-goods load usually works out nearer 22 CBM once pallets, access, dunnage and securing are allowed for, which in practice means something like 800 to 1,200 cartons. So the real question is how few cartons per line you are willing to buy. In the lists we help build for first-time Gulf buyers, the count usually settles somewhere between 20 and 40 lines, which works out at roughly 20 to 60 cartons per line: enough range to fill a shelf, few enough that every line still ships in whole cartons.
Can 1.3G and 1.4G fireworks travel in the same container?
Often yes, but it changes the entire load. Fireworks sit in compatibility group G, and the IMDG permitted mixed-stowage table allows group G together with group G in one closed cargo transport unit. The catch is in the same chapter: where a mixed load spans different divisions, the whole load is treated as the more dangerous division, and the stowage arrangement has to meet the most stringent provisions for the entire load. Adding a single 1.3G-classified line therefore makes the whole box a 1.3 shipment, which can also raise what the destination approval has to cover. What matters is the classification on the approval documents, not whether the item is sold as consumer or professional product.
Is a fireworks container limited by weight, volume or explosive quantity?
Almost never by weight. Consumer fireworks are bulky and light, so a container cubes out well before it approaches a payload rating in the region of 28 tonnes, and destination road limits frequently bring the practical weight figure down to somewhere between 21 and 24 anyway. The two ceilings that actually bite are practical loaded volume, around 22 CBM in a 20ft mixed load, and net explosive quantity. The NEQ figure that constrains you is often not the carrier's but the one written into the importer's licence and magazine capacity at destination. Plan against those two, then check gross weight last.
What should go in a first container for a new Gulf market?
Weight it towards product that is easy to sell and hard to get wrong: multi-shot cakes as the commercial core, fountains and sparklers as dependable family lines, and a modest novelty block. Keep genuinely experimental lines to a small share, because unsold stock in a licensed Gulf magazine occupies capacity you will want for the next season. Before the list is drawn at all, confirm which divisions and product types the importer's licence actually permits.
What does the factory need from us to work out a container plan?
Five things, and a finished SKU list is not one of them: the destination and the licensed quantity at the receiving magazine, the container size you have in mind, the selling window you are shipping for, a budget range, and either a draft line list or simply the categories you want covered. From that we can return export carton dimensions, units per carton, cube per line and net explosive content per line, which is everything the arithmetic needs. The one figure we cannot supply is the licensed quantity at your end, because that sits with the importer of record.
Can one container cover both Eid and a National Day?
It can, and for a smaller market it often should: one shipment, two selling windows, one shipment-approval cycle instead of two. Be clear about what is consolidated, though. It is the approval attached to the shipment; sales and event permissions at destination are still handled season by season. The trade-off is that the earlier season sets the arrival date, so the later season's stock waits in storage through the hottest part of the year. Where the windows are far apart, or storage is limited or not climate controlled, two smaller loads usually protect both product condition and cash flow better than one large arrival.
How is a container for one event different from a retail-season container?
An event load is built backwards from the show and its approvals rather than forwards from a shelf. Quantities follow the firing plan instead of an assortment, the arrival date is fixed by the permit chain rather than by the season, and the buyer is frequently a contractor rather than a distributor. A retail assortment is judged over a whole season on range and sell-through. An event load has one test: is all of it there, in working order, on the date.
Official Sources & Where to Verify
Load planning sits on transport law at one end and destination licensing at the other, and both get revised. Treat the figures here as planning inputs rather than as authority, and confirm the specifics for your own consignment against the primary sources that actually govern each question:
- Mixed stowage and segregation — the IMDG Code, Part 7, which carries the permitted mixed-stowage table for Class 1 goods and the rule that a mixed-division load takes the more stringent treatment. The Code is amended on a two-year cycle, so check which amendment is in force for your sailing date: imo.org dangerous goods
- Divisions and compatibility groups — the UN Recommendations on the Transport of Dangerous Goods, from which the IMDG classification structure derives, together with the Manual of Tests and Criteria that decides which division an article is assigned: unece.org dangerous goods
- Container capacities and payload — internal dimensions and payload ratings vary by equipment type and manufacturer, and destination road limits are frequently stricter than the container's own rating. Take these from the equipment specification for the booking in question, from your carrier or forwarder, rather than from any general table including this one.
- The licensed quantity at destination — held by the importer of record, and issued by the explosives or civil defence authority in the destination state. This covers both how much explosive content the magazine may hold and which divisions and product types the licence extends to. It is the figure that most often decides how large a load can be, and no supplier can supply it for you.
- Product construction and packaging standards — GSO adoptions such as the EN 15947 series govern what may be placed on a Gulf market and how consumer packs are labelled. They decide what can be sold rather than what can be stowed, so they belong in the assortment decision but not in the stowage calculation: GSO EN 15947-5:2021 record
- Your dangerous-goods forwarder — carrier-specific acceptance conditions and any NEQ limit applied per container or per vessel, which sit on top of the Code rather than in it.
